The global market for Wafer Cutting Surfactant was valued at US$ 7674 million in the year 2024 and is projected to reach a revised size of US$ 10330 million by 2031, growing at a CAGR of 4.4% during the forecast period.

Wafer cutting surfactant is a concentrated, aqueous-based solution of wetting agents and surfactants that reduces heat build-up and move swarf particles away from the kerf during the saw dicing process.
The global market for semiconductor was estimated at US$ 579 billion in the year 2022, is projected to US$ 790 billion by 2029, growing at a CAGR of 6% during the forecast period. Although some major categories are still double-digit year-over-year growth in 2022, led by Analog with 20.76%, Sensor with 16.31%, and Logic with 14.46% growth, Memory declined with 12.64% year over year. The microprocessor (MPU) and microcontroller (MCU) segments will experience stagnant growth due to weak shipments and investment in notebooks, computers, and standard desktops. In the current market scenario, the growing popularity of IoT-based electronics is stimulating the need for powerful processors and controllers. Hybrid MPUs and MCUs provide real-time embedded processing and control for the topmost IoT-based applications, resulting in significant market growth. The Analog IC segment is expected to grow gradually, while demand from the networking and communications industries is limited. Few of the emerging trends in the growing demand for Analog integrated circuits include signal conversion, automotive-specific Analog applications, and power management. The Asia Pacific region is the most important semiconductor component production hub in the world and is expected to remain so during the forecast period. The ever-expanding ingenuity of the government has firmly attracted the consciousness of global competitors to establish regional productive institutions. The region is a major semiconductor manufacturer in the world, hence the demand for dicing surfactants is noteworthy. Most of these factories are expected to be the focus of attention in Japan and China, which is expected to open up better opportunities for dicing equipment in the long-term future. These factors contribute to the Asia Pacific region having the largest market share of cutting surfactants.
